Output 80b85d84b66ac4f57df2e9a2bd31d11ec4198eeccab3c144766926ab99911a5d:1

value
3561693
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 14b36b70e621d4b5292d33096dd26bb512554d45 OP_EQUALVERIFY OP_CHECKSIG
address
12tTT8rDRdX8KSvZpxb3rWXj2MZTgPqf3b
transaction
80b85d84b66ac4f57df2e9a2bd31d11ec4198eeccab3c144766926ab99911a5d
spent
true